【简易用】跟着我学 C++ 01
0、前言
本文仅发布在 CSDN 和 CNBlogs (博客园),发现盗用作品请于作者联系
0.1、C++ 是什么
学习 C++ 最好要有任何一门编程语言的基础
下面的教程适用于 Microsoft Windows 系统
0.2、资源(提取码:suse)
- Dev-Cpp.6.3-beta2.GCC.10.2.Setup.exe (Dev-C++6.3 安装程序)
- Hello World.zip (本课源码,需解压)
1、安装环境
我们使用 Dev-C++ 这个轻量化的编辑器来编写 C++ 程序,这样不需要过多的学习成本
下载完 Dev-C++ 安装程序后,我们只需双击它,然后一直下一步(安装路径允许自定义)就可以了
(对,就那么多,恭喜你安装完成!)
2、初识 Dev-C++
2.1、打开 Dev-C++
安装完成后,我们可以在桌面或开始菜单打开 Dev-C++
图2.1
Dev-C++ 在桌面上的图标
图2.2 Dev-C++ 在开始菜单上的图标
2.2、Dev-C++ 的界面
图2.3 Dev-C++ 的界面
(我就不多说了,直接放大看图吧!)
3、第一个 C++ 程序——输出 Hello World!
3.1、新建一段空的 C++ 代码
有两种方式可以创建源代码:
- 在 Dev-C++ 的左上方依次点击文件、新建、源代码
- 用快捷键:Ctrl + N
图3.1 新建一段空的 C++ 代码
3.2、输出 Hello World!
我们先来看对应的代码:
#include<iostream>
using namespace std;
int main(){
cout<<"Hello World!";
return 0;
}
图3.2 工具栏里的”编译运行“按钮
把这段代码复制到 Dev-C++ 里,点击工具栏里的”编译运行“按钮(图3.2)就会弹出一个 DOS 窗口(图3.3)
图3.3 C++程序的运行结果
下面,我们看一下这里的代码这样写的原因(在 C++ 中“//”后面的都是注释,编译时不会将注释写进程序)
#include<iostream> //整句话的意思是:把"iostream"(输入输出流)这个库包含到我们的程序里
using namespace std; //"std"是standard(标准)的缩写,整句话的意思是:使用标准命名空间
int main(){ //主函数的入口
cout<<"Hello World!"; //"cout"表示 C++ 的输出,"<<"也表示输出
return 0; //这里返回了一个参数,因为主函数的类型是"int"(整型),所以返回数字0
} //因为主函数有一个大括号,所以这里别忘了以大括号结尾
4、本课总结
我们安装了 Dev-C++ ,也对它有了初步的认识,还学会了 C++ 代码的基本结构和“cout”语句。